ποΈ What is Devin?
The first fully autonomous AI software engineer by Cognition. Can plan and execute complex engineering tasks end-to-end.
Devin is particularly strong at genuinely autonomous β can plan and execute multi-step engineering tasks, handles tasks end-to-end with minimal hand-holding, and can work in parallel on multiple tasks, making it a popular choice for automating well-defined bug fixes and feature tickets and offloading repetitive engineering tasks from a team. One thing to keep in mind: usage-based credit pricing can be unpredictable and costly.
π What are Devin's pros and cons?
Pros
- Genuinely autonomous β can plan and execute multi-step engineering tasks
- Handles tasks end-to-end with minimal hand-holding
- Can work in parallel on multiple tasks
- Learns and adapts within a session using its own sandbox
Cons
- Usage-based credit pricing can be unpredictable and costly
- Still requires review β output isn't always production-ready
- Best suited to well-scoped tasks rather than ambiguous ones

π° How much does Devin cost?
Devin is a paid product billed on a credit/usage basis, with plans starting around $20/month for a limited number of Agent Compute Units and higher tiers for teams.
Core
- Limited monthly Agent Compute Units (ACUs)
- Autonomous task planning & execution
- IDE and Slack integration
Team
- Pooled ACUs across a team
- Parallel task execution
- Priority support
Enterprise
- Custom ACU volume
- SSO & advanced security
- Dedicated support
